**Q: What happens if Keyturner fails mid-rotation?**

Keyturner, our internal secrets-rotation utility, writes a checkpoint before each rotation step. If a run aborts, do not re-run blindly — first roll back to the checkpoint from the Keyturner console so downstream services keep valid credentials. The rollback command prompts for the checkpoint recovery passphrase, which is recorded on the following line.

unlock words, yahif-yajef: kasok-julax-norael-gorael-istox-normir-istael

Subject: Handover — ParityScan maintenance

Effective next Monday, maintenance of ParityScan, our hotel rate-parity checker, transfers to a new owner as part of the team reshuffle. Current state: the scraper pool is stable, the mismatch classifier has two open bugs, and the nightly report job was recently migrated to the new scheduler. Pending reviews should be reassigned accordingly. For review requests and escalations, contact the engineer named below.

account owner for fajep-yagef: Kasix Eliiel

MEMO — Dispatch desk

Stage props for the "Gildenmere Follies" tour ship tonight: one crate, padded, fragile mechanisms inside. Carrier is Oakspan Transit, pickup 18:00 from bay 2. Paperwork travels in the lid pouch. Venue crew at the Thistledown Hall receives at dawn. Release to their steward only on the phrase below.

handover note for yagef-bagep: the drudor pelius courier leaves the kasdor zorvan norir ledger at gate 8016 under passcode 755406